Justin Charles' public defenders say their client's statements shouldn't be admissible at trial because he was in a fragile mental and emotional state following his Dec. 29 arrest at a Cambria County funeral home.
The Tribune-Democrat of Johnstown ( http://bit.ly/MkR1ks) reports Charles was arrested and police took custody of the baby's body prior to the procession to the cemetery.
Investigators say Justin Charles fatally shook his son, also named Justin, on Dec. 21. The boy died two days later.
Authorities say the 24-year-old man confessed to the boy's death.
Prosecutors said Friday they expect the statements to be admitted at trial.
